Program Manager Contractor Salary for Microsoft

If you`re looking to work as a contractor for Microsoft as a program manager, you may be wondering what kind of salary you can expect. Program manager contractors at Microsoft are responsible for overseeing projects and ensuring that they are completed effectively and efficiently. This can involve collaborating with cross-functional teams, managing timelines and budgets, and working with stakeholders to ensure project success.

According to Glassdoor, the average base salary for a program manager contractor at Microsoft is $138,000 per year. This figure is based on salaries reported by current and former employees, and it may vary depending on factors such as experience level, location, and specific role responsibilities.

In addition to base salary, program manager contractors at Microsoft may also be eligible for bonuses and other forms of compensation. According to data from Payscale, the average total compensation for a program manager contractor at Microsoft is around $150,000 per year.

It`s also worth noting that working as a contractor for Microsoft can offer certain benefits, such as flexible work arrangements and the ability to work on a variety of projects. However, contractors may not have access to certain benefits that full-time employees receive, such as health insurance and retirement plans.
